Encyclopedia > Breeders' Cup Mile

The Breeders' Cup Mile is a 1-mile Grade 1 Weight for Age stakes race for thoroughbred racehorses three years old and up run annually since 1984 at a different racetrack in the United States or Canada as part of the Breeders' Cup. The current purse is $1.5 million.

Year Winner Jockey Trainer Time
2005 Artie Schiller Garrett Gomez James Jerkens 1:36.10
2004 Singletary David Flores (jockey) Don Chatlos 1:36.90
2003 Six Perfections Jerry Bailey Pascal Bary 1:33.86
2002 Domedriver Thierry Thulliez Pascal Bary 1:36.88
2001 Val Royal Jose Valdivia, Jr. Julio Canani 1:32.05
2000 War Chant Gary Stevens Neil Drysdale 1:34 3/5
1999 Silic Corey Nakatani Julio Canani 1:34 1/5
1998 Da Hoss John Velazquez Michael Dickinson 1:35 1/5
1997 Spinning World Cash Asmussen Jonathan Pease 1:32 3/5
1996 Da Hoss Gary Stevens Michael Dickinson 1:35 4/5
1995 Ridgewood Pearl Johnny Murtagh John Oxx 1:43 3/5
1994 Barathea Frankie Dettori Luca Cumani 1:34 2/5
1993 Lure Mike E. Smith Shug McGaughey 1:33 2/5
1992 Lure Mike E. Smith Shug McGaughey 1:32 4/5
1991 Opening Verse Pat Valenzuela Dick Lundy 1:37 2/5
1990 Royal Academy Lester Piggott Vincent O'Brien 1:35 1/5
1989 Steinlen José Santos D. Wayne Lukas 1:37 1/5
1988 Miesque Freddie Head François Boutin 1:38 3/5
1987 Miesque Freddie Head François Boutin 1:32 4/5
1986 Last Tycoon Yves St.Martin Robert Collet 1:35 1/5
1985 Cozzene Walter Guerra Jan Nerud 1:35
1984 Royal Heroine Fernando Toro John Gosden 1:32 3/5
